Basic Information

Dong Yang, female, associate professor, Department of Public Administration, School of Public Management, Liaoning University.

Email: dongyang@lnu.edu.cn

 

Introduction

Graduated from School of Government, Peking University

Research Interests: Public service; Government Performance Management; Social Governance; Human Resource Development and Management; Non-profit Organization Governance and Evaluation.

 

Major Courses

Public Administration”; “Human Resource Management in the Public Sector”; “Administrative Organization”; “Selected Readings of Classics of Public Administration”;

 

Research Results

She has published a number of papers in “Chinese Public Administration”, “Administrative Tribune” and “Inner Mongolia Social Sciences”. Hosted the National Social Science Fund Youth Project “Research on the Performance Evaluation of Government Purchase of Public Services from the Perspective of Public Responsibility”; Presided over the Liaoning Provincial Social Science Planning Fund Project “Research on the Performance Evaluation of Liaoning Government's Purchase of Elderly Care Services”; Participated in the National Social Science Fund project "Research on the linkage mechanism between the government's purchase of public services from social forces and the reform of public institutions"; Participated in the Sino-British cooperation project "The government purchased public services from social forces Empirical research ".
